Geography

El Sunchal is situated at an altitude of approximately 1,000 meters above sea level, making it an ideal destination for n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ts. The town is surrounded by dense forests, crystal-clear rivers, and majestic mountains, providing a breathtaking backdrop for hiking, bird watching, and other outdoor activities. The climate in El Sunchal is mild and pleasant throughout the year, making it a popular destination for visitors looking to escape the hustle and bustle of city life.

Info about El Sunchal

  • Country: Argentina
  • State/Province: Tucuman
  • Population: N/A
  • Latitude: -26.60931
  • Longitude: -65.04266
